About Toxic Tort Law in Croatia

Toxic tort law in Croatia deals with cases where individuals have been harmed by exposure to toxic substances. These cases can involve personal injury, property damage, or other harm caused by exposure to hazardous materials. Toxic tort cases can be complex and require the expertise of a lawyer familiar with this area of law.

Why You May Need a Lawyer

You may need a lawyer in a toxic tort case if you have suffered harm due to exposure to toxic substances. Common situations where you may require legal help include contaminated drinking water, exposure to harmful chemicals at work, or environmental pollution affecting your property or health. A lawyer can help you navigate the legal process, gather evidence, and seek compensation for your damages.

Local Laws Overview

In Croatia, toxic tort cases are typically governed by environmental laws, civil liability laws, and other regulations that address exposure to hazardous substances. It is important to work with a lawyer who understands these laws and can help you build a strong case for compensation. Additionally, Croatia is a member of the European Union, so EU regulations may also play a role in toxic tort cases.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: What is a toxic tort case?

A toxic tort case involves harm caused by exposure to toxic substances, such as chemicals, pollutants, or other hazardous materials.

Q: How do I prove a toxic tort case in Croatia?

Proving a toxic tort case in Croatia typically requires gathering evidence of exposure, harm, and a link between the two. A lawyer can help you navigate this process.

Q: What kind of compensation can I receive in a toxic tort case?

Compensation in a toxic tort case can include medical expenses, lost wages, property damage, pain and suffering, and other damages related to the harm caused by exposure to toxic substances.

Q: Is there a time limit for filing a toxic tort case in Croatia?

Yes, there is a statute of limitations for filing a toxic tort case in Croatia. It is important to consult with a lawyer as soon as possible to ensure your rights are protected.

Q: Can a class action lawsuit be brought in a toxic tort case in Croatia?

Class action lawsuits are possible in Croatia, but they are not as common as individual toxic tort cases. Your lawyer can advise you on the best course of action for your situation.

Q: What should I do if I suspect I have been exposed to toxic substances?

If you suspect you have been exposed to toxic substances, seek medical attention immediately. Then, contact a lawyer who can help you determine if you have a viable toxic tort case.

Q: How can a lawyer help me in a toxic tort case?

A lawyer with experience in toxic tort cases can help you gather evidence, negotiate with responsible parties, and seek compensation for your damages. They can also guide you through the legal process and represent your interests in court, if necessary.

Q: What are the potential defenses in a toxic tort case?

Defenses in a toxic tort case may include lack of evidence of exposure, contributory negligence on the part of the plaintiff, or the expiration of the statute of limitations. Your lawyer can help you address these defenses and build a strong case for compensation.
